Shots Wins 'Company of the Year' at EAN Awards

HANNOVER — Shots won Company of the Year Award at the EAN and Sign Awards, held during the eroFame trade show last week in Hannover, Germany. And Shots won the EAN award for Fetish Brand of the Year for its Ouch! line of BDSM products.

Shots’ EAN and Sign wins follow other industry awards the company has had in 2016, including Pleasure Product Company of the Year from XBIZ and Foreign Manufacturer of the Year from StorErotica. Shots also won Best New Product Range for Vive at the Adultex Awards.

“2016 will go into the Shots history books as one of the most successful and busiest years ever,” a company representative said. 

In 2016, according to Shots, “Vive got introduced to the market and became an instant worldwide hit.”

A Shots representative said, “Shots has also taken their marketing campaigns to a whole new level. They started the year with a massive window display for their brand Vive at the Harmony pilot store, located on Oxford St. in London. Vive was there on display for two whole months. A simple calculation shows that about 33 million people have been reached during that period. And that’s not all; they also released several new types of marketing materials for their various brands, and produced some amazing photo shoots in unique locations with their products.”

Shots said, “We still have a lot of tricks up our sleeve for the upcoming year. We don’t want to spoil the surprise for now, but we are convinced that 2017 will be our year.”
